General description
KLH-conjugated linear peptide corresponding to 21 amino acids from the N-terminal half of human Alpha(B)-crystallin.
~20 kDa observed; 20.16 kDa calculated. Uncharacterized bands may be observed in some lysate(s).
Application
Western Blotting Analysis: A 1:1,000 dilution from a representative lot detected alpha B-crystallin in mouse eye and human retina tissue lysate.
Immunohistochemistry Analysis: A representative lot detected alpha B-crystallin in Immunohistochemistry applications (Nahomi, R.B., et. al. (2019). J. Immunol. Methods. 467; 37-47).
ELISA Analysis: A representative lot detected alpha B-crystallin in ELISA applications (Nahomi, R.B., et. al. (2019). J. Immunol. Methods. 467; 37-47).
Inhibition Analysis: A representative lot inhibited the chaperone and anti-apoptotic activities of alpha B-crystallin. (Nahomi, R.B., et. al. (2019). J. Immunol. Methods. 467; 37-47).
Immunofluorescence Analysis: A representative lot detected alpha B-crystallin in Immunofluorescence applications (Nahomi, R.B., et. al. (2019). J. Immunol. Methods. 467; 37-47).

Biochem/physiol Actions
Clone aB1788G7G6 is a mouse monoclonal antibody that detects Alpha(B)-crystallin. It targets an epitope within 21 amino acids within the N-terminal half.
Physical form
Purified mouse monoclonal antibody IgG1 in PBS without preservatives.
Preparation Note
Stable for 1 year at -20°C from date of receipt. Handling Recommendations: Upon receipt and prior to removing the cap, centrifuge the vial and gently mix the solution. Aliquot into microcentrifuge tubes and store at -20°C. Avoid repeated freeze/thaw cycles, which may damage IgG and affect product performance.
